๐ First, the Basics: What’s the Difference?
Before diving into the benefits, it’s important to clarify the roles of bookkeeping and accounting:
-
Bookkeeping is the day-to-day process of recording financial transactions (sales, expenses, payroll, invoices, etc.).
-
Accounting involves interpreting, classifying, analyzing, reporting, and summarizing that financial data to provide insights.
Together, they create a clear, complete picture of your business’s financial health.

๐ธ 2. Improved Cash Flow Management
Cash flow is the lifeblood of any growing business. Even profitable companies can fail if they run out of cash.
Good bookkeeping helps you:
-
Monitor your cash position in real time
-
Forecast future cash needs
-
Avoid late payments or overdraft fees
-
Plan for seasonal fluctuations or unexpected expenses
๐ก Growth depends on having the cash to fund it — and accurate accounting keeps you in control.
๐ 3. Clear KPIs and Performance Tracking
Growth requires tracking progress over time — and that means having clear, measurable Key Performance Indicators (KPIs).
With organized financial data, you can monitor:
-
Gross profit margins
-
Customer acquisition costs
-
Operating expenses
-
Return on investment (ROI)
-
Revenue growth trends
๐ These insights help you identify what’s working — and what’s not — so you can double down on growth opportunities.
